How to fill out 2019-2020 financial aid request

01
Gather necessary documents, including tax returns and W-2 forms.
02
Complete the FAFSA form online at fafsa.ed.gov.
03
Include your school code to ensure your application is sent to the correct institution.
04
Provide accurate information about your income, assets, and household size.
05
Review your application for any errors before submission.
06
Submit your application by the deadline of June 30, 2020.
07
Check the status of your application and any additional documents requested by your school.

The 2019-2020 financial aid request refers to the documentation and application process for students seeking financial assistance for the academic year that spans from 2019 to 2020.
Students who are planning to attend college or university during the 2019-2020 academic year and seek financial aid, such as grants, loans, or work-study, are required to file the request.
To fill out the 2019-2020 financial aid request, students typically need to complete the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A) form, providing information about their financial situation, family income, and other relevant details.
The purpose of the 2019-2020 financial aid request is to assess a student's financial need and determine their eligibility for federal, state, and institutional financial aid programs.
Students must report their personal information, income, tax information, number of dependents, and other financial details, along with information about the colleges they plan to attend.
